#include "fdlibm.h"
int
__fpclassifyf (float x)
{
unsigned int w;
GET_FLOAT_WORD(w,x);
if (w == 0x00000000 || w == 0x80000000)
return FP_ZERO;
else if ((w >= 0x00800000 && w <= 0x7f7fffff) ||
(w >= 0x80800000 && w <= 0xff7fffff))
return FP_NORMAL;
else if ((w >= 0x00000001 && w <= 0x007fffff) ||
(w >= 0x80000001 && w <= 0x807fffff))
return FP_SUBNORMAL;
else if (w == 0x7f800000 || w == 0xff800000)
return FP_INFINITE;
else
return FP_NAN;
}
int
__fpclassifyd (double x)
{
unsigned int msw, lsw;
EXTRACT_WORDS(msw,lsw,x);
if ((msw == 0x00000000 && lsw == 0x00000000) ||
(msw == 0x80000000 && lsw == 0x00000000))
return FP_ZERO;
else if ((msw >= 0x00100000 && msw <= 0x7fefffff) ||
(msw >= 0x80100000 && msw <= 0xffefffff))
return FP_NORMAL;
else if ((msw >= 0x00000000 && msw <= 0x000fffff) ||
(msw >= 0x80000000 && msw <= 0x800fffff))
/* zero is already handled above */
return FP_SUBNORMAL;
else if ((msw == 0x7ff00000 && lsw == 0x00000000) ||
(msw == 0xfff00000 && lsw == 0x00000000))
return FP_INFINITE;
else
return FP_NAN;
}
